Show ST LOUIS FINALLY WINS FROM THE WHITE SOX ST. LOUIS, April 25. St. Louis Jrove Danforth to cover in the second inning and scored enough runs on Kerr, who relieved Danforth, to win today's to-day's game from Chicago, 7 to 2. Gallia Gal-lia pitched splendidly after the first, inninjr, when a pass to E. Collins and Jackson's home run scored two runs. Score : CHICAGO. AB. R. H. PO. A. E.
